Kajiado West MP George Sunkuiya on the evening of November 14 commissioned the construction of Phase I of the Saikeri Secondary School project valued at Ksh 10 million, marking an important step in expanding education access across the constituency.
The new secondary school is being built from the ground up and is expected to support a smooth transition for learners moving to secondary level. Its establishment responds to growing enrolment in primary institutions and the increasing need for more secondary school spaces within the Saikeri community.
The project is expected to reduce congestion in neighboring schools and shorten the long distances many students currently cover to access secondary education. It also aligns with national efforts to improve the transition rate from primary to secondary education while promoting long term academic growth in the region.

MP Sunkuiya also confirmed that in the coming weeks, the National Government Constituency Development Fund (NGCDF) will complete three new classrooms at Ilkilorit Primary School. The work includes procurement of student desks to enhance the learning environment and ensure pupils study in comfortable, well equipped spaces. These investments underline ongoing efforts to strengthen education facilities and support both learners and teachers across Kajiado West.
The Saikeri Secondary School project together with the upgrades at Ilkilorit Primary School reflect MP Sunkuiya’s commitment to improving education infrastructure and supporting the academic success of future generations.
